

This webinar is designed to equip parents with practical tools and insights to actively support their children in learning mathematics from home. The session will focus on making mathematics part of everyday life, nurturing curiosity, and building a strong foundation for confident problem-solving.

Speakers:
Prof. June Decker – Professor of Mathematics, Emeritus (19 years), Connecticut State Community Colleges; former middle & high school teacher and co-author of the Connecticut Model Algebra I & II Curriculum – https://lnkd.in/dry4BJy7 , https://lnkd.in/dFtNmFv5 .
She holds a BA in Philosophy & Psychology from Harvard College, an MSc in Mathematics from the University of Connecticut, and a Teaching Certification in Mathematics from Central Connecticut State University.
She also serves as a volunteer with American Friends of Kenya – https://www.afkinc.org/
Prof. Decker believes students learn best by actively engaging in mathematics and has dedicated her career to helping learners truly understand and enjoy the subject.
James Mburu – A trained Mathematics teacher and currently coordinating foundational numeracy programs at Mizizi Elimu Afrika, supporting strong math foundations for young learners.
Nyakinyua Gathura – Founder, Ann’s Maths Club, passionate about nurturing a love for mathematics and supporting learners to excel.
